    Problem:

    Hello. I bought a Selore &S-Global hub for my Macbook Pro 2021, M1 Silicon. I'm running MacOS v14.6.1. I want to connect my monitor via HDMI. The monitor recognizes the hub on all ports (i.e. the 'no device connected' screen turns off), but doesn't show up on the Mac Displays and the screen stays black.

    Troubleshooting:

    I tried three monitors:

    • Old 1080p monitor with DVI to HDMI adapter.
    • 4K Samsung TV via HDMI.
    • 4K Dell montitor via HDMI.

    The TV displays a message saying power to the hub might too low. I switched my regular Macbook charger for a bigger one, of 140W, which should be more than enough. No changes.

    Tried connecting the 4K Monitor via USB-C (it has a USB-C port). Same result.

    Tried a different M1 Macbook Pro. No changes.

    All other ports work OK.

    Hello @Selore Global,

    I believe I got it working. Connection from Selore to MacBook seemed to be the issue. Product came without USB-C cable (though promised on box), so I improvised with an old one I had. I bought a new one, Type C Gen 2 (5A) and seems to be working well. Will update if anything changes.
